Output eb8139b67f07f23d6076b3964f9aa67509731bcd8b8999d98b86831b82df7b54:9

value
56789636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a39c5bc13bae25b85d422eae8a348e3da7afb70e OP_EQUAL
address
3Gc7NnWLrxwntFpRS6oaNTKJpW8Byj11eF
transaction
eb8139b67f07f23d6076b3964f9aa67509731bcd8b8999d98b86831b82df7b54
spent
true